How do you perceive the weaknesses in your life? Do you see them as flaws in your character you’d rather conceal?

Or do you, like spiritual thought-leader, Dr. Michael Beckwith, see a weakness as simply “a strength in its embryonic state”?

When we think about our strengths, we usually feel them as an expansive, high-frequency vibration. The opposite is true when we think about our weaknesses — which are usually felt as a constrictive, low-frequency vibration.

So, by embracing the high vibrations of your strengths and shifting those expansive emotions into an area of weakness, you can “activate” the innate strength within your seeming weaknesses.

ABOUT MICHAEL BECKWITH:

Michael Beckwith is the founder of Agape International Spiritual Center, a spiritual community which today counts a membership of 9,000 individuals who study and practice New Thought–Ancient Wisdom. He was one of the featured teachers in The Secret and has appeared on The Oprah Winfrey Show and Larry King Live.
